European women: first time Casa Azzurri ‘in pink’

(ANSA) – ROME, 07 JUL – For the first time on the occasion of a final phase of a women’s tournament, the FIGC opens the doors of “Casa Azzurri”, the home of supporters and national team partners, for the Women’s European Championship in England. On the occasion of the three matches scheduled in the group, with France on 10 July, with Iceland on 14 and with Belgium on 18, meeting at “Casa Azzurri England”, in Manchester, at “The Anthologist” in St. Peter’s Square, a location in the heart of the city, where the Italians will play the second and third matches of the tournament (at the Academy Manchester City Stadium).

Confirming the growing interest on the part of the media, companies and fans for women’s football, and in particular for the national team, which already won the sympathy of fans at the 2019 World Cup, with record numbers on TV and on social networks , “Casa Azzurri England” will be the meeting place for all the Italians following the European Championship and a precious point of reference for the Italian community in Manchester as well.

“Casa Azzurri confirms itself as the home of all football fans – comments the manager of the Business Area of ​​the FIGC, Giovanni Valentini – and will accompany the blue for the duration of the European Championship. Over the years Casa Azzurri has become a promotional tool in the world of all the Italian excellences: in addition to sports entertainment, in fact, we proudly export the food and wine, music, tourism and culture of our country to the world “.

At “Casa Azzurri England” it will be possible to watch the Azzurre matches on giant screens, with a dedicated bar and restaurant service. Inside the structure, which can accommodate up to 250 people, the official products of the national team will be available, including the exclusive Puma Liberty jersey that the women’s selection will wear at the European Championships.
